St. Anthony’s Canossian Secondary School Overview

Founded in 1879 as St. Anna’s School and later renamed St. Anthony’s Convent School in 1894, St. Anthony’s Canossian Secondary School has a rich history rooted in Canossian heritage. This government-aided autonomous girls’ school embodies the motto “Via, Veritas, Vita” (The Way, The Truth, The Life), with an educational philosophy centered on Canossian values like charity, humility, and forgiveness. It’s all about shaping “Canossians of Influence,” young women empowered to lead with integrity and compassion.

What sets it apart? As a Catholic institution, it offers affiliations with St. Anthony’s Canossian Primary School and Canossa Catholic Primary School, providing priority for affiliated students. It’s also a designated school for students with moderate to profound hearing loss using an oral approach, complete with barrier-free accessibility and Special Educational Needs Officers. Plus, its niche in performing arts education adds a creative edge, distinguishing it from other secondary schools and fostering well-rounded growth.

St. Anthony’s Canossian Secondary School Admission Process

Getting into St. Anthony’s Canossian Secondary School starts with understanding the PSLE cut-off points, which for the 2025 intake (based on recent data) are attainable and encouraging. For affiliated students, ranges include Posting Group 3 (10-22), Posting Group 2 (21-25), and Posting Group 1 (26-28). Non-affiliated cut-offs are Posting Group 3 (10-14), Posting Group 2 (21-25), and Posting Group 1 (25-28). These reflect the AL scores of the last admitted students, with lower scores being better in the new system.

Affiliation gives priority, so if your child attended an affiliated primary, that’s a plus. Direct School Admission (DSA) opens doors too, with categories focusing on talents in performing arts, sports, and leadership, details available on the school website by early May. The process involves applications, trials, and interviews to showcase your child’s strengths.

St. Anthony’s Canossian Secondary School Curriculum and Academic Excellence

At St. Anthony’s Canossian Secondary School, the curriculum is designed to spark curiosity and build strong foundations. Core subjects include English, Mathematics (both Elementary Math and Additional Math), Sciences (like Biology, Chemistry, Physics), and Humanities (Geography, History, Literature). Electives expand horizons with options such as Drama, Music, Nutrition and Food Science, and Principles of Accounts, aligning with diverse interests.

St. Anthony’s Canossian Secondary School Facilities and Extracurricular Activities

Picture modern facilities that inspire learning: smart classrooms, well-equipped science and computer labs, a spacious library, sports complexes, and arts studios, all recently upgraded for accessibility. These spaces support hands-on exploration and creativity, perfect for busy families seeking environments that nurture growth.

Extracurricular activities, or CCAs, are vibrant and categorized to build character:

  • Sports: Badminton, Floorball, Netball, Taekwondo, Tennis, Track and Field, Handball—great for teamwork and health.
  • Performing Arts: Choir, Concert Band, Guitar Ensemble, Percussion Ensemble, Angklung/Kulintang, Modern Dance, Indian Dance, English Drama—aligning with the school’s arts niche and DSA opportunities.
  • Uniformed Groups: Girl Guides, National Civil Defence Cadet Corps (NCDCC)—fostering discipline and service.
  • Clubs and Societies: Audio Visual Aid, Debating and Public Speaking, Film, Media Resource Library, Home Economics—encouraging leadership and community involvement.

These CCAs contribute to holistic development, helping girls discover passions while boosting resilience and potential scholarships.

What is the history of St. Anthony’s Canossian Secondary School?
Founded in 1879 as Saint Anna’s School, it became St. Anthony’s in 1886 and was taken over by Canossian Sisters in 1893 for girls’ education. It relocated to Bedok North in 1995, achieved autonomous status in 2002, and has a legacy of nurturing women through Catholic values. The school celebrated its centenary with events like musical dramas.

What support does St. Anthony’s Canossian Secondary School offer for special educational needs?
The school provides specialised support for students with moderate to profound hearing loss using the oral approach, along with barrier-free facilities and Special Educational Needs Officers for inclusive education.
